  … Dangote Angry Because We Refused To Raise Price Of Sugar During Ramadan- BUA Aliko Dangote, leader and founder of the Dangote group has petitioned the Federal government, requesting that the BUA Sugar Refinery be shut down. Dangote Group, in a letter jointly signed by the Aliko Dangote and the Chairman, flour mills of Nigeria PLC, John Coumantaros, sighted by THE WHISTLER, said that the commissioning of the BUA Port Harcourt refinery is an act intended to undermine the National Sugar Master Plan of the Federal Government. The group noted that according to the mid-term review conducted by the national sugar development council, BUA has faulted by failing to invest substantively in local production of sugar. It called for investigations to determine the quality of raw sugar imported by the refinery in Port-Harcourt and the appropriate penalty in terms of duty (60 per cent) and levy (10 per cent) to be imposed on the company. Minister Denies Saying Nigerians Without NIN Could Be Jailed for 14 Years

Image
  Communications Minister Isa Pantami has denied saying Nigerians who do not obtain their National Identification Numbers (NIN) could risk a 14-year jail term. The minister said he was quoted out of context. “This has been quoted out of context. Pantami has not mentioned “14 years imprisonment.” But said NIMC (National Identity Management Commission) has been 14 years in existence, since 2007,” he said in a tweet. Pulse has obtain the video of Pantami’s media briefing and here is what he said: “We only said submit your national identity to your mobile operator. Then citizens said we don’t have it, let us go and obtain it. Then the first question, why did you fail to obtain until when the issue of SIM came up. “National identity is a law and it is mandatory. And for you to even conduct certain activities in this country without the number is an offence. “For you to get voters card in Nigeria based on section 27 of NIMC act (without NIN) is an offence. FG Declares 2 Days Public Holidays

Image
The Federal Government has declared Friday 2nd and Monday 5th April, Public Holidays to mark this year’s Easter Celebration. Minister of Interior, Ogbeni Rauf Aregbesola made the declaration on Tuesday.  He urged Christians to emulate the attributes of forbearance, forgiveness, kindness, humility, love, peace and patience, which were demonstrated by Jesus Christ. He called on Christians to use the occasion of this year’s Easter Celebration to pray for the Peace, Unity, and Progress of our country. Corruption Deeply Rooted In Nigeria: Justice Rhodes-Vivour

Image
A rqetired Supreme Court Justice, Olabode Rhodes-Vivour, on Monday lamented that corruption is still deeply rooted in Nigeria like any other country in the world. He however canvassed that concerted efforts must be put in place in order to reduce the anormally to the barest minimum. . The apex court Justice who bowed out of the bench on attaining 70 years yesterday pleaded that corruption must be tackled headlong through genuine efforts so as to make life more meaningful for the citizenry. At a valedictory court session held in his honour at the Supreme Court complex, Justice Rhodes-Vivour said Nigeria is no exception when it comes to corruption. He added that what should be done is to reduce it to the barest minimum. “Corruption exists in all the countries of the world. Nigeria is no exception.
